Australia's Chief Scientist Issues Climate Change: The Story So Far. (October 12, 2013)

 

A new paper released by the Office of the Chief Scientist yesterday summarises the changes to the global climate that are already happening.

The paper, ‘Climate Change: The story so far’ states that “While the future impacts of climate on global systems remain uncertain, there is increasing evidence that the activities of humans are changing the climate now”.

 

Including sections on the increased concentration of greenhouse gases and surface warming, the paper has been released to inform the public on the current findings of climate science.
